Stylish bar at the entrance to the Seventh district that is a favourite meeting place for media
folk. In the daytime the “Centre” feels more like a relaxed café with its big window seats,
but it turns livelier later as the music and the crowds arrive. Good salads and sandwiches.
Mon-Fri 8.30am-1am, Sat 4pm-2am, Sun 4-11pm.

This one-
time motorcycle repair shop (the name means “clutch”) is accessed via a graffiti-splattered
corridorleadingintoaconcretecourtyardmaskedwithweirdlypaintedmurals.Alime-green-
coloured bar runs the length of one side, while the remaining space is taken up with simple
wooden bench seating, table football (
csocsó
) and ping-pong.
Mon-Thurs & Sun 3pm-2am,
Fri-Sat 4pm-5am.

One
of the busiest bars on Kazinczy utca, with a large summertime garden next door, good food
and great music on the stage at the back. The name comes from the owner of the factory that
once stood here.
Mon-Wed 5pm-midnight, Thurs 5pm-3am, Fri-Sat 5pm-5am.

Anotherofthe
major ruin bars, though a little more clean-cut, this massive complex centres around a bistro-
like lounge, to the side of which is a small bar and stage, where there is regular live music.
In May the brick wall at the back is ceremoniously knocked down, opening up an enorm-
ous gravel-bedded garden.
Most
is also one of the better
kerts
for food, and is especially
popular for its breakfasts and brunches (1690Ft).
Mon-Wed & Sun 10am-2am, Thurs-Sat
10am-5am.

There's not much by
way of a sign on the tatty metal door, but go through and you'll find yourself in a verdant
yard, with the bar straight ahead, and a room with sofas and table football off to the left. The
“Spare Key” is a laid-back kind of place with a reputation built largely on the strength of its
live music programme, ranging from klezmer and Roma bands to underground, folk and jazz.
Mon-Wed & Sun 5pm-1.30am, Thurs-Sat 5pm-2.30am.
